The story of Jim Ed Richards began in 1884 in Kentucky. In 1900, Jim Ed Richards resided in Gradyville, Adair, Kentucky, USA. In 1930, Jim Ed Richards resided in District 4, Adair, Kentucky, USA. Jim Ed Richards married Mary Elizabeth Janes, Mary Lizzie Janes, and had children including Artie E Richards, Hobson Richards, James Roy Richard, Jessie Richard, Leslie T Richards, Nancy F Richards, Walter Richards. Jim Ed Richards passed away in 1968 in Gradyville, Adair County, Kentucky, United States of America.
